质点运动型问题就是在三角形、四边形等一些几何图形上,设计一个或几个动点,并对这些点在运动变化的过程中相伴随着的等量关系、变量关系、图形的特殊状态、图形间的特殊关系等进行研究考察,质点运动型问题常常集几何、代数知识于一体,数形结合,有较强的综合性.解决质点运动型问题需要用运动与变化的眼光去观察和研究图形,把握动点运动与变化的全过程看,抓住其中的等量关系和变量关系,并特别关注一些不变量、不变关系或特殊关系,尽管一些试题大多属于静态的知识和方
